XV of France: the phenomenon Antoine Dupont

2020-10-25T18:17:51.820Z


At each exit, the young scrum half of the Blues amazes a little more. At 23, he is already the boss of the French game and one of his strongest offensive assets. 


Saturday night, he burst the screen.

One more time.

An overflowing activity, incessant outbursts.

To put his team in the right direction again and again.

Against Wales, Antoine Dupont nourished his growing reputation, that of a world-class player hailed as such by all his opponents.

Confirmed his status: he is currently one of the top three scrum backs in the world.

Against the Welsh, the Toulousain scored two tries, always in support, in the right place, to finish the blows.

He was also decisive on the test of his captain, Charles Ollivon: a new number in the red defense, in panic, before serving him up.

Three decisive actions, but also a role of distributor and a strategic vision that is always correct, with its occupation kicks wisely to reverse the pressure.

To see him also master of his subject, so uninhibited, we would sometimes forget that he is only 23 years old.

But, we know, to well-born souls, value does not await the number of years.

Antoine Dupont played his first Top 14 matches at 18, under the Castres jersey.

Before joining, three years later, a Stade Toulousain under reconstruction.

Result?

A title of champion of France in 2019. A coronation awaited for seven years by the red-and-black people.

In the French team, his rise was also meteoric.

A first selection at 20 years old.

A role of understudy then, quickly, he entered the costume of the boss.

Until becoming essential.

Today, he is the catalyst of the offensive and daring game advocated by the new staff of the XV of France headed by Fabien Galthié.

Former scrum half, the coach was not wrong.

Dupont's potential, he detected it for a long time.

In 2017, then manager of RC Toulon, he tried to recruit him.

In vain.

But the combination of robustness and liveliness, his winning temper, his lucidity and his temerity, had convinced him: the XV of France had a nugget there, the big number 9 which had been lacking for too long.

"I am amazed by this kid", wrote Fabien Galthié, in a column for L'Équipe.

“It seems out of the ordinary to me.

By its physical qualities, but not only.

The others turn to him, he reassures the team about his ability to find solutions and even to defend.

And he has that extra thing, that ability to break the line or clean bad balls.

If I were his coach, I would give him carte blanche… ”A piece of advice that he now applies.

But Antoine Dupont is not just a brilliant soloist.

At 23, but already 25 selections, he has taken a real ascendancy over the France group.

This leadership role, the Gersois has always assumed.

Even claimed.

“In my job, you have to like to command,” he told us during the World Cup in Japan.

And always know how to manage your emotions. ”

Cool head and fiery legs.

The perfect combination.

Perfection that continues off the pitch.

Antoine Dupont is praised by supporters and journalists, his teammates and his opponents.

It could make him lose his mind.

But, again, its maturity is surprising.

And reassure.

With Romain Ntamack, he is the head of the gondola of this new-look, rejuvenated and ambitious XV de France.

Who seeks nothing less than the world title in three years on his land.

He could take advantage, make his diva, pull the blanket to him.

It is quite the reverse.

Number 9 at Stade Toulousain is reserved and humble.

Aware of the expectations weighing on him, he lives it without stress but also without ego swelling.

"I know that I am a little more put forward than the others, that the press talks a lot about me," he repeats regularly.

But I don't get carried away.

Those who know him well assure however that it boils inside.

Let him not neglect anything, think constantly of the game, of the means to do better.

Eternal dissatisfied.

The key to success.
